Jack Nicholson Calls It Quits, Cites Memory Loss

Jack Nicholson is reportedly retiring from acting, if rumors are to be believed. Radar is reporting that Jack Nicholson has quietly retired from the movie business. The Hollywood Icon hasn’t retired from public life, he’s just stopped working. You will still see Jack Nicholson sitting courtside at Lakers’ games.

After a career that spanned five decades, 76-year-old Hollywood legend Jack Nicholson reportedly has no plans appear in films again.

A Hollywood insider told Radar “Jack has — without fanfare — retired. There is a simple reason behind his decision — it’s memory loss. Quite frankly, at 76, Jack has memory issues and can no longer remember the lines being asked of him. His memory isn’t what it used to be.”

Jack Nicholson hasn’t made a film since 2010, when he worked with Reese Witherspoon, Paul Rudd and Owen Wilson in “How Do You Know.” The three-time Academy Award winner was courted by the producers for the upcoming film “Nebraska” for the part of an aging, booze-addled father who “makes the trip from Montana to Nebraska with his estranged son in order to claim a million dollar Mega Sweepstakes Marketing prize.”

Jack Nicholson told the producers he wasn’t interested and the part will be played by Bruce Dern.

Jack Nicholson started as a gofer for William Hanna and Joseph Barbera, who made classic cartoons, at MGM’s animation studio in the 1950s. He left to move into acting. Jack Nicholson, who was born in Neptune, N.J., made his first film appearance starring in the 1958 low-budget teen movie, “The Cry Baby Killer.”

Jack Nicholson is the most nominated male actor in Academy Awards history. Jack Nicholson won Best Actor honors at the Academy Awards his parts in “One Flew Over the Cuckoo’s Nest” and “As Good as It Gets.” Nicholson the Best Supporting Actor Oscar for “Terms of Endearment” in 1983. Jack Nicholson holds the record for most Academy Award Nominations with eight for Best Actor and four for Best Supporting Actor.

The source said “Jack has no intention of retiring from the limelight.” The source said he will still be part of the the Hollywood party circuit, “He’s not retiring from public life, at all. He just doesn’t want a tribute. He’s happy to tacitly join the retirees club like Sean Connery.”
